零基础入门:虚幻4游戏开发(021)- 画质设置与资源管理

需积分: 0 0 下载量 28 浏览量 更新于2024-06-30 收藏 15.13MB DOCX 举报
本篇教程是"从零开始学虚幻4游戏开发系列021",主要针对初学者介绍如何使用虚幻4引擎开发游戏,特别是利用其易于上手的蓝图可视化编程系统。教程分为几个关键部分: 1. **开始前的准备**:这部分首先引导读者了解虚幻4引擎的基础概念,涉及安装步骤,需通过EpicGamesLauncher进行,建议注册Epic账号以便下载。安装时选择默认路径,确保安装CoreComponents作为引擎核心。 2. **蓝图系统**:蓝图是虚幻4引擎的一大亮点,它通过图形化界面帮助开发者创建游戏逻辑,无需编写大量代码。在本教程中,蓝图系统将作为开发游戏的主要工具。 3. **材质**:讲解如何在虚幻4中管理和创建游戏对象的外观,即材质的使用,这对于视觉效果至关重要。 4. **UI设计**:用户界面(UI)的设计在这里也会被提及,如何通过虚幻4创建游戏内的交互元素,提升用户体验。 5. **创建简单游戏**:这部分会具体指导如何利用上述工具实际构建一款基础游戏,包括游戏角色、动画和音效的集成。 6. **动画和音效**:动画对于游戏的真实感和玩家体验有很大影响,教程会介绍如何在虚幻4中处理角色动画。音效设计则涉及音频资源的导入和在游戏中应用。 7. **默认游戏资源**:StarterContent提供了免费的初始资源,如模型和材质,供开发者在项目初期使用。TemplatesandFeaturePacks则包含预先定义的功能模板,可根据项目需求快速搭建游戏框架。 8. **安装选项详解**:安装时可以选择包含的组件,如StarterContent(提供基础资源)、TemplatesandFeaturePacks(预设功能模板)和EngineSource(引擎源码),这些选项有助于新手更快上手。 通过本教程,新手玩家不仅能掌握虚幻4的基本操作,还能了解到如何利用可视化工具进行游戏开发,从而逐步构建出自己的游戏作品。整个学习过程注重实践操作,使理论与实践相结合,助力读者迅速入门虚幻4游戏开发。